如何定制一款高效安全的虚拟币交易APP?

引言

随着数字货币市场的蓬勃发展,越来越多的用户开始关注虚拟币的交易。虚拟币交易APP作为连接用户与交易所的桥梁,需求量急剧增加。企业和个人希望通过定制一款高效、安全的虚拟币交易APP,来满足不断变化的市场需求和用户体验。本文将详细探讨定制虚拟币交易APP的方方面面,包括市场分析、核心功能、安全性考虑、技术架构以及如何保证良好的用户体验等多方面内容。

市场分析

在开发一款虚拟币交易APP之前,首先需要进行市场分析,以了解目前市场上的竞争情况、用户需求及市场趋势。近年来,加密货币的价格波动明显,用户的投资意愿增加,从而推动了虚拟币交易APP的需求。

现有市场上已出现了多款知名的虚拟币交易应用,如Coinbase、Binance和Huobi等。这些平台的成功与失败提供了宝贵的经验教训。用户在选择交易APP时,除了价格、交易对和手续费外,安全性、用户界面设计、功能丰富性及客户支持等也成了重要的考量因素。

研究市场数据显示,当前年轻用户群体对交易APP的使用率显著提升,他们更愿意使用流畅、直观的APP,且对社交化交易和个性化的功能有较高的需求。此外,随着法规的逐步完善,监管标准也在不断提高,因此在APP定制中满足合规要求显得尤为重要。

定制虚拟币交易APP的核心功能

当确定了目标市场和用户需求后,下一步就需要明确APP的核心功能。这些功能应能满足用户的基本交易需求并增加附加值,以增强用户黏性。以下是虚拟币交易APP的一些核心功能:

  1. 账户管理:用户应能轻松注册、登录、找回密码等。同时,提供多种身份验证方式,如短信验证码、邮箱验证及更高级的生物识别技术。
  2. 交易功能:支持现货交易、杠杆交易、期货交易等,且具备实时K线图、深度图等交易工具。
  3. 安全保障:采用多重签名、冷钱包等方式保护用户资金安全,确保交易过程中的数据加密传输。
  4. 市场行情:提供实时的市场行情,显示每一种虚拟币的最新价格、涨跌幅和交易量等信息,帮助用户做出投资决策。
  5. 用户社区:增加社交互动功能,让用户可以分享自己的交易见解,进行知识交流。
  6. 客户支持:提供在线客服、FAQ及社区支持,快速响应用户问题。

安全性考虑

在金融领域中,安全性无疑是最重要的因素之一。尤其是在虚拟币交易中,用户的资金和数据面临诸多安全挑战。为了保护用户信息和资产安全,虚拟币交易APP需要以下安全措施:

  1. 数据加密:采用高级加密标准(AES)和SSL协议,确保所有数据在传输中不会被黑客窃取。
  2. 多重身份验证:为了提升账号的安全性,建议在登录和交易时启用双重或多重身份验证。
  3. 冷钱包存储:用户的大部分资金应存储在冷钱包中,以避免被在线攻击者盗取。只有在进行交易时才将资金转入热钱包。
  4. 安全审计:定期进行安全审核,识别和修复APP中的潜在安全漏洞。
  5. 偏好设置:允许用户根据自己的需求设置出入金的安全级别,比如限制每次交易的最大金额。

技术架构

一款高效的虚拟币交易APP通常需要可扩展的技术架构,以支持高并发和大数据量的交易。以下是构建虚拟币交易APP时需要考虑的技术要素:

  1. 编程语言:后端可以选用Python、Java或者Node.js等语言,前端则可以使用React、Vue或Angular等技术,以提高APP的响应速度及用户体验。
  2. 数据库:选择合适的数据库系统,关系型数据库如MySQL可以用来存储用户资料和交易记录,而非关系型数据库如MongoDB则适合存储市场行情等实时数据。
  3. API接口:提供稳定的API接口,以便与第三方服务进行对接,如KYC身份验证、银行转账等,同时也需要保证API的安全和性能。
  4. 服务器架构:可采用负载均衡和云计算的解决方案,以提高系统的稳定性和扩展能力,确保在交易高峰期不会宕机。
  5. 监控与调试:实时监控系统的运行状态,通过日志系统及时发现并解决问题。

如何保证良好的用户体验

用户体验是影响虚拟币交易APP成功的重要因素。良好的用户体验不仅能吸引新用户,还能提高现有用户的活跃度和忠诚度。下面介绍一些提升用户体验的策略:

  1. 简洁直观的界面:设计简洁、易于操作的用户界面,避免复杂的操作流程直观展示用户所需功能。
  2. 交易流程:最大程度减少用户交易的步骤,比如通过一键交易、历史订单快速复投等功能来简化流程。
  3. 提供个性化服务:根据用户的交易习惯和偏好,提供个性化的内容和交易建议,提升用户的满意度。
  4. 及时反馈:在交易过程中及时告知用户交易状态,比如延迟、成功、失败等信息,避免造成用户的困惑。
  5. 完善的帮助中心:建立丰富的帮助中心和FAQ,用户在遇到问题时能够迅速找到解决方案。

相关问题探讨

1. 如何从用户需求出发,设计虚拟币交易APP的功能?

在设计虚拟币交易APP的功能时,必须深入理解目标用户的需求与痛点。首先,可以通过问卷调查、用户访谈以及市场调研等方式收集用户反馈,了解他们需要哪些功能。其次,分析用户的行为模式,根据用户在交易app上的常见操作,判断哪些功能应优先实现。此外,必须关注行业动态,随时调整功能以适应市场变化。例如,随着DeFi(去中心化金融)的兴起,很多用户开始关注流动性挖矿和收益聚合器等新兴功能,因此在设计APP时应考虑整合这些新元素。

功能设计不仅需要基于用户反馈,还要确保技术可行性和商业模式的完整性。与开发团队密切合作,提前评估各项功能的开发成本与实现难度,将用户需求与资源配置相结合,制定优先级。

2. 虚拟币交易APP的合规问题有哪些?

合规是虚拟币交易APP开发中不可忽视的重要环节。由于涉及到金融监管,各国对虚拟币的政策和法规各不相同,这要求开发者在进行APP设计时要充分考虑合规性。研发团队应当对目标市场所适用的KYC(了解你的客户)与AML(反洗钱)政策进行研究,确保APP在用户注册、资金转入、交易等环节,都能满足监管机构的要求。

实际上,合规的要求不仅仅涉及到用户身份验证,还包括接受政府财务部门的审计及定期更新合规报告等。同时,建议与专业法律顾问合作,及时了解和调整APP设计中的法律风险。此外,数据保护与信息泄露的合规措施也至关重要,开发团队应确保用户的数据隐私不被侵犯。

3. 如何提升虚拟币交易APP的安全性?

提升虚拟币交易APP的安全性需要从多个层面入手。首先,在用户身份验证方面,引入双重验证及生物识别技术能有效防止账户被盗。同时,所有用户信息应采用加密技术存储,确保数据泄露的风险最小化。

其次,作为交易平台,APP应具备多重签名、冷热钱包等安全机制。将绝大部分数字资产存储于冷钱包,减少黑客攻击的可能性。在交易过程中应进行实时监控,一旦发现异常交易行为或可疑登录,将及时冻结账户并通知用户。

此外,定期进行安全漏洞评估及修复也是必要的工作,可以通过渗透测试、代码审计等方式,及时发现潜在的安全隐患。

4. 如何通过市场推广提高虚拟币交易APP的用户活跃度?

推广策略对于虚拟币交易APP的成功至关重要。首先,可以通过社交媒体平台进行高效传播,利用行业KOL的影响力,将目标用户聚集到APP中。同时,可以通过空投、交易返佣、活动奖励等方式吸引用户注册和活跃。

其次,内容营销也不可忽视,提供优质的教育内容,如虚拟币基础知识、交易策略、市场分析等,可以吸引潜在用户的关注。通过不断的知识分享,构建用户对平台的信任,增强用户黏性。

最后,重视用户反馈,提高用户满意度,鼓励用户分享应用,形成良好的口碑效应。这将有助于进一步提高用户的活跃度与留存率。

5. 虚拟币交易APP的市场前景如何?

虚拟币交易APP的市场前景非常广阔,随着加密资产的逐渐被主流金融机构接受,数字货币的应用场景也在不断增加。随着更多的用户了解和参与加密货币,市场对专业、安全而便捷的虚拟币交易APP的需求只会进一步增长。

同时,随着技术的不断发展,去中心化金融(DeFi)、NFT(非同质化代币)等新兴领域的崛起,都为交易平台提供了新的发展机遇。突破传统中心化交易所的局限,构建多元化的交易模型,将有助于拓展市场份额。

最后,随着全球对数字货币监管的逐步完善,合规性的APP将能够更加安心地为用户服务,进而提升市场竞争力。因此,在这样的背景下,投资虚拟币交易APP的潜力无疑是巨大的。

结语

定制一款虚拟币交易APP需要全面考虑市场、用户需求、安全性、技术架构等多方面因素。通过深入市场调研、科学设计功能与体验、重视合规与安全,将有助于打造出一款成功的交易平台。未来的数字货币市场依然充满机遇,只要紧跟潮流、不断创新,企业便能把握这波数字货币发展的浪潮。